The signal quality of the transmission link in a communication base station determines the network coverage, communication stability, and user experience. Among these, the digital-to-analog converter (DAC) serves as a critical component in the base station‘s transmission link, converting digital signals to analog signals. Its resolution, conversion speed, linearity, and noise performance affect the fidelity of the RF signal. This paper recommends the use of the GXSC 14-bit resolution, broadband high-performance, low-power CMOS DAC. The chip features a plastic TSSOP28 package, enabling pin-to-pin replacement of the AD9764.

The GXSC analog-to-digital converter delivers outstanding AC and DC performance while supporting an update rate of up to 125 MSPS. Fabricated with advanced CMOS technology and featuring a segmented current source architecture, it minimizes stray elements and enhances dynamic performance, perfectly meeting the signal conversion requirements of communication base station transmit chains.
The GXSC analog-to-digital converter integrates an edge-triggered input latch and a 1.25V temperature-compensated bandgap reference to provide a complete monolithic DAC solution. Differential current output supports both single-ended and differential applications. In differential output mode, the matching between the two current outputs affects dynamic performance. The current output can be directly connected to an output resistor to provide two complementary single-ended voltage outputs or directly output to a transformer.

The GXSC analog-to-digital converter features on-chip reference and control amplifiers that deliver maximum precision and flexibility. These amplifiers can be driven by either an internal reference voltage or various external reference voltages. The internal control amplifier provides a wide adjustment range (>10:1), enabling the chip‘s full-scale current to be adjusted within the range of 2mA to 20mA while maintaining excellent dynamic performance. Consequently, the GXSC analog-to-digital converter can operate at lower power levels or be adjusted within a 20dB range to provide additional gain variations.

Advantages of GXSC Analog-to-Digital Converter Products:
Pin-to-pin compatible with AD9764
Single-channel 125MSPS, 14-bit resolution DAC
Differential current output: 2mA to 20mA
Power consumption: 88mW (@3.3V)
Single 3.3V power supply
On-chip 1.25V reference
Edge-triggered latch
Sampling rate: 125 MSPS
The package is a plastic TSSOP28
Static Performance: DNL -1.5/+1.5 LSB, INL -2.5/+2.5 LSB
